Output 58ae7206eed9ae7a821692eb97a9b46d7c5b57deeeaca0a5f6c1faf18db46ef0:0

value
66021000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e3bcc44618f37e70c786242d97d9701b63986a9 OP_EQUAL
address
MDaDm9zeamY7tVuThP7x3wXxz88no5SjJw
transaction
58ae7206eed9ae7a821692eb97a9b46d7c5b57deeeaca0a5f6c1faf18db46ef0
spent
true